Abstract

The invention discloses a method and a system for recognizing and beautifying nails by any curved surface, wherein the method for recognizing and beautifying nails by any curved surface comprises the following steps: acquiring curvature information of a target nail; dividing the target nail into a plurality of curved surface areas to be manicured according to the curvature information and planning a manicure path of each curved surface area to be manicured; according to the nail beautifying path and the distance value within the preset range, performing curved nail beautifying on the curved surface area of the nail to be beautified along the nail beautifying direction, so that the target nail forms more than one nail beautifying layer; wherein, the nail beautifying direction is a direction vertical to the curved surface area of the nail to be beautified; the curved-surface nail art includes more than one of the following steps of curved-surface pattern texture drawing, curved-surface pure color drawing, curved-surface gradient color drawing, curved-surface sealing layer and curved-surface ornament attaching. The invention realizes high nail-beautifying efficiency, high nail-beautifying pattern resolution, high definition and no ink floating.

Technical Field
The invention relates to the technical field of nail art, in particular to a method and a system for recognizing nail art on any curved surface.
Background
With the increasingly explosive fire in the nail art, the nail beautifying behavior becomes a fashion behavior of young women, and simultaneously, a huge market prospect is formed. Because at present in the first operation of machine beautiful, use plane air brushing technique, when drawing nail curved surface pattern, pattern distortion can appear, pattern resolution reduces, the pattern definition is poor, phenomenons such as ink wafing, the effect that the machine was drawn is inferior a lot than the effect of the manual first beautiful of first beautiful teacher, but the manual efficiency that draws first beautiful of first beautiful teacher is lower again, and first beautiful effect still has direct relation with first beautiful individual technological level, same first beautiful pattern, the effect that different first beautiful artists drawn has very big difference. Therefore, it is highly desirable to provide a nail art having high nail art efficiency, high pattern resolution, high definition, and no ink scattering.
Disclosure of Invention
The invention provides a method and a system for recognizing and beautifying nails by any curved surface, which realize high nail beautifying efficiency, high nail beautifying pattern resolution, high definition and no ink floating.
The technical scheme provided by the invention is as follows:
a nail-beautifying method by recognizing any curved surface comprises the following steps:
acquiring curvature information of a target nail;
dividing the target nail into a plurality of curved surface areas to be manicured according to the curvature information and planning a manicure path of each curved surface area to be manicured;
according to the nail beautifying path and the distance value within the preset range, performing curved nail beautifying on the curved surface area of the nail to be beautified along the nail beautifying direction, so that the target nail forms more than one nail beautifying layer; wherein, the nail beautifying direction is a direction vertical to the curved surface area of the nail to be beautified; the curved-surface nail art includes more than one of the following steps of curved-surface pattern texture drawing, curved-surface pure color drawing, curved-surface gradient color drawing, curved-surface sealing layer and curved-surface ornament attaching.

In an embodiment of the present invention, as shown in fig. 1, a method for recognizing and beautifying nail on an arbitrary curved surface includes the steps of:
acquiring curvature information of a target nail;
dividing the target nail into a plurality of curved surface areas to be manicured according to the curvature information and planning a manicure path of each curved surface area to be manicured;
according to the nail beautifying path and the distance value within the preset range, performing curved nail beautifying on the curved surface area of the nail to be beautified along the nail beautifying direction, so that the target nail forms more than one nail beautifying layer; wherein, the nail beautifying direction is a direction vertical to the curved surface area of the nail to be beautified; the curved-surface nail art includes more than one of the following steps of curved-surface pattern texture drawing, curved-surface pure color drawing, curved-surface gradient color drawing, curved-surface sealing layer and curved-surface ornament attaching.
In this embodiment, the curved surface area to be beautiful may be divided according to the size of the curvature, for example, the curvature is within a certain range and the adjacent nail curved surfaces are curved surface areas to be beautiful, the curved surface areas to be beautiful may be sequentially arranged along the width direction of the target nail, the curved surface areas to be beautiful may be sequentially arranged along the length direction of the target nail, and the curved surface areas to be beautiful may be irregularly sequentially arranged. The first beautiful route of the first beautiful curved surface region of back treating can be gone on the basis of the first beautiful curved surface region of treating, if treat first beautiful curved surface region can follow the width direction of target nail and arrange in proper order when, when accomplishing the first curved surface of treating first beautiful curved surface region first beautiful, only need to move to the first beautiful curved surface region of treating next along the width direction of target nail, and rotate certain angle for the first curved surface region of treating next realizes the first beautiful of curved surface of vertical direction, thereby accomplish the first beautiful process of target nail, and then accomplish the first beautiful of curved surface of all nails. In practical application, the target nail may be one nail to be beautiful, or one curved surface region to be beautiful of the previous target nail may be finished, and then one curved surface region to be beautiful of the next target nail may be finished, until the nail beauty of all the target nails is finished.
In practical application, the preset range distance values of the same curved surface pattern, the curved surface pure color, the curved surface gradient color, the curved surface sealing layer and the curved surface ornament can be the same or different, and the preset range distance values can be set according to actual needs and can be set according to empirical range values or preset range values. Of course, the predetermined range of distance values for the same type of inkjet pigment or decoration is preferably the same. But the distance value in the preset range for simultaneously spraying more than two kinds of spraying paint can be set according to the optimal spraying quality. Of course, the predetermined range of distance values for different types of inkjet paints or decorations may be the same. Specifically, the setting can be performed according to actual needs. In practical application, more than one curved surface area to be manicured is curved to be manicured, the number of the manicure layers formed in the same curved surface area to be manicured can be more than one, at least more than one curved surface area to be manicured is curved to be manicured, and the number of the layers of the manicure layers in different curved surface areas to be manicured can be the same or different. The colors of the curved surface areas of different nails to be beautiful on the same nail layer can be the same or different; the colors of the same curved surface area to be beautiful on the nail layers on different layers can be the same or different. The nail layer can be in the same color or different colors, the formed pattern can be a curved surface pattern texture, such as cartoon characters, plants, characters, letters, characters, geometric figures and the like, the pure color of the curved surface can be white, transparent, red, black, blue and the like, and the gradient color of the curved surface is that the same nail layer has more than two colors. The curved surface gradient can form patterns with artistic aesthetic feeling such as rainbow, blue sky and white cloud, and the decorations can be beads, diamonds, patches, plane decorations, etc. The ornament, the curved surface pattern, the curved surface pure color, the curved surface gradient color and the curved surface seal layer form a nail beautifying shape with artistic aesthetic feeling.

In an embodiment of the present invention, on the basis of the above embodiment, the acquiring curvature information of the target nail includes:
acquiring length and width profile information and curved surface information of the target nail;
and acquiring curvature information of the target nail according to the length, width and contour information and the curved surface information.
In the embodiment, by acquiring the length and width profile information of the target nail and the curved surface information of the area where the target nail is located, the curvature information of each target nail can be accurately acquired according to the combination of the length and width profile information and the curved surface information, so that the situation that spray painting pigments are sprayed to the places outside the target nail is effectively avoided, and the situation that a user mistakenly beautifies the nails outside the target nail is eliminated.
In an embodiment of the present invention, on the basis of the above embodiment, the acquiring length and width profile information and curved surface information of the target nail specifically includes:
acquiring an image frame of the target nail according to the image, and acquiring length and width contour information of the target nail according to the image frame; the laser point source sensor acquires the curved surface information of the target nail; wherein the optical path of the laser point source sensor covers the target nail.
In this embodiment, the image frame including the target nail is obtained from top to bottom through the camera, and then the length and width profile information of the target nail is obtained, and then the curved surface information of the target nail is obtained from top to bottom through the laser point source sensor with the light path covering the target nail. In practical application, in order to ensure complete curved surface information of the target nail, the cross section of the light path of the laser point source sensor is certainly not smaller than the surface of the target nail, so that the curved surface information acquired by the laser point source sensor is actually larger than the target nail, and accurate curvature information of the target nail can be acquired after the length and width profile information of the target nail is combined.
In an embodiment of the present invention, different from the above embodiment, the acquiring length and width profile information and curved surface information of the target nail specifically includes:
acquiring an image frame of the target nail according to the image, and acquiring length and width contour information of the target nail according to the image frame; the method comprises the following steps that a laser point source sensor conducts two-dimensional scanning on a target nail along the length direction and the width direction of the target nail to obtain curved surface information of the target nail; wherein the light spot of the laser point source sensor is smaller than the target nail.
In this embodiment, the smaller the spot diameter of the laser point source sensor, the higher the resolution of the curved surface of the nail is, the image frame including the target nail is obtained from top to bottom by the camera, the length and width profile information of the target nail is further obtained, the curved surface information of the target nail is obtained by moving the laser point source sensor in two dimensions (i.e., along the width direction and the length direction of the target nail, respectively), and the curvature information of the target nail is obtained by combining the length and width profile information of the target nail and the curved surface information of the target nail. In practical application, in order to ensure complete curved surface information of the target nail, the curved surface information obtained in the moving process of the laser point source sensor is actually larger than the target nail, so that after the length and width profile information of the target nail is combined, accurate curvature information of the target nail can be obtained.
In an embodiment of the present invention, different from the above embodiment, the acquiring length and width profile information and curved surface information of the target nail specifically includes:
acquiring an image frame of the target nail according to the image, and acquiring length and width contour information of the target nail according to the image frame; the method comprises the following steps that a laser line source sensor conducts one-dimensional scanning on a target nail along the length direction or the width direction of the target nail to obtain curved surface information of the target nail; the laser line source sensor is composed of a plurality of laser points which are arranged in a linear array; the length of the light path of the laser line source sensor is not less than the length or width of the target nail.
In this embodiment, the smaller the spot diameter of a single laser point is and the larger the number of laser points is, the higher the resolution of the obtained nail curved surface is. In practical application, in order to ensure complete curved surface information of the target nail, the curved surface information acquired by the laser line source sensor in the process of moving along the width direction or the length direction of the target nail is actually larger than that of the target nail, so that after the length and width profile information of the target nail is combined, accurate curvature information of the target nail can be acquired.
In an embodiment of the present invention, different from the above embodiment, the acquiring length and width profile information and curved surface information of the target nail specifically includes:
acquiring an image frame of the target nail according to the image, and acquiring length and width contour information of the target nail according to the image frame; the laser dot matrix sensor is used for statically acquiring curved surface information of the nail at one time on the target nail above the target nail; the laser dot matrix sensor is composed of a plurality of laser dots which are arranged in an array; the length size and the width size of the laser dot matrix sensor are not smaller than those of the target nail.
In this embodiment, the smaller the spot diameter of the laser spot of the laser dot matrix sensor is and the larger the number of the laser spots is, the higher the resolution of the obtained nail curved surface is. The one-time static state is that the cross section of the laser dot matrix sensor is not smaller than the surface of the target nail, so that the laser dot matrix sensor does not need to move when acquiring the curved surface information of the target nail.
